> Check the headers for such messages, the poster probably posted using a
> broken client that destroyed the headers used for threading.  Posting
> clients need to keep, and add to, the references headers, and change the
> in-reply-to header, for threading to work properly.  Screw that up, as
> many crap clients are apt to, and threading is ruined.  Using subject
> lines and dates for message sorting is not threading.

+1

Note that the Yahoo webmail client is one of the worst offenders in this
regard, at least judging by many of the broken threads on this list.
